Leach line repair services involve addressing issues related to the underground drain lines that carry wastewater away from a property. These services typically include locating the damaged or collapsed sections of the leach line, excavating the affected area, and replacing or repairing the faulty pipe segments. Proper repair ensures that the drainage system functions effectively, preventing potential backups and water-related problems within the property’s septic system.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to diagnose the condition of the leach line and perform repairs with minimal disruption to the surrounding landscape.
Problems that often lead property owners to seek leach line repair include persistent odors, slow drainage, or sewage backups in the plumbing system. Over time, the leach line can become clogged, cracked, or collapsed due to soil movement, root intrusion, or aging materials. These issues can cause wastewater to surface on the property or seep into the surrounding soil, creating health hazards and property damage. Timely repairs help mitigate these risks, restoring proper flow and ensuring the septic system operates safely and efficiently.

Cost Range for Leach Line Repair - The typical cost for leach line repairs can vary from approximately $1,200 to $4,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method chosen. For example, minor repairs might be closer to $1,200, while extensive replacements could reach higher amounts.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- Factors such as soil conditions, accessibility of the leach field, and the size of the system can affect the overall expense. Costs may also increase if excavation or additional landscaping work is required.
Average Cost for Complete Replacement - Replacing an entire leach line system often ranges between $3,500 and $7,000. This includes removal of old components, installation of new lines, and site restoration in Oakley, CA, and nearby areas.
Cost for Minor Repairs - Minor repairs, such as patching or replacing small sections, typically cost between $800 and $2,000. These repairs are less invasive and may be sufficient for localized issues within the leach field.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is leach line repair? Leach line repair involves fixing or replacing the drain lines used in septic systems to ensure proper wastewater flow and prevent backups or leaks.
How do I know if my leach line needs repair? Signs include persistent odors, standing water around the drain field, slow draining fixtures, or sewage backups in the home.
What causes leach line problems? Common causes include root intrusion, soil compaction, improper installation, or age-related deterioration of the drain lines.
What methods are used for leach line repair? Local service providers may use trenchless repair techniques, pipe replacement, or complete drain field replacement depending on the issue.
How can I prevent leach line issues? Regular inspections, avoiding planting deep-rooted vegetation near the drain field, and conserving water can help maintain leach line health.
